Cros de Romet is the passion project project for Alain Boisson, younger brother to Bruno Boisson and member of Domaine Boisson since the late 1990’s. Cros de Romet’s first vintage was in 2003. With a pure focus in mind Alain makes the one wine, Cairanne Rouge. With Alain being a big history buff, his symbol of the bottle is the Templar Cross. Back in the 1300’s, the village of Cairanne was an outpost for the Knight’s Templar.
80% Grenache, 20% Syrah. The grapes are 65% destemmed, and vinified in concrete tank for 20-30 days. The wine is aged in 80% concrete tank and 20 in demi-muids barrels(600L) for 8-10 months before bottling.
